من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ب
سؤال فى الداتا جريد فيو - نسخة قابلة للطباعة

+- منتدى فيجوال بيسك لكل العرب | منتدى المبرمجين العرب (http://vb4arb.com/vb)
+-- قسم : قسم لغة الفيجوال بيسك VB.NET (http://vb4arb.com/vb/forumdisplay.php?fid=182)
+--- قسم : قسم اسئلة VB.NET (http://vb4arb.com/vb/forumdisplay.php?fid=183)
+--- الموضوع : سؤال فى الداتا جريد فيو (/showthread.php?tid=27393)



سؤال فى الداتا جريد فيو - احمد خطاب - 11-11-18

لسلام عليكم عندى قاعدة بيانات مش عارف اعمل كود اضافة وتعديل وحفظ وبحث

  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        'load all colummns of 'table in access 2007
        Dim da As New OleDbDataAdapter
        Dim dt As New DataTable
        da = New OleDbDataAdapter("select *From custmer", con)
        da.Fill(dt)
        DataGridView1.DataSource = dt


RE: سؤال فى الداتا جريد فيو - rmnr - 11-11-18

هذا الكود يشمل الإضافة والتعديل والحذف في داخل الداتاجريد
زر لتحديث البيانات التي جرت داخل الداتاجريد في قاعدة البيانات
البحث بواسطة مربع نص
كود :
Dim con As New OleDbConnection("Provider=Microsoft.ACE.OleDb.12.0; Data Source=|DataDirectory|\Database1.accdb")

Dim da As New OleDbDataAdapter("Select * From [custmer]", con)
Dim dt As New DataTable
Dim WithEvents bind As New BindingSource

Private Sub Form1_Load(ByVal sender As Object, ByVal e As EventArgs) Handles MyBase.Load
   da.Fill(dt)
   bind.DataSource = dt

   DataGridView1.DataSource = bind
End Sub

Private Sub bind_PositionChanged(ByVal sender As Object, ByVal e As EventArgs) Handles bind.PositionChanged
   Me.Text = (bind.Position + 1) & " / " & bind.Count
End Sub

Private Sub Button1_Click(ByVal sender As Object, ByVal e As EventArgs) Handles Button1.Click
   Dim bld As New OleDbCommandBuilder(da) With {.QuotePrefix = "]", .QuoteSuffix = "["}
   da.Update(dt)
   MsgBox("تم تحديث البيانات")
End Sub

Private Sub TextBox1_TextChanged(ByVal sender As Object, ByVal e As EventArgs) Handles TextBox1.TextChanged
   bind.Filter = "[cName] Like '%" & TextBox1.Text.Trim & "%'"
End Sub



RE: سؤال فى الداتا جريد فيو - احمد خطاب - 11-11-18

شكرا جداا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ااااا اخى وصديقى العزيز هجرب الكود واكلم حضرتك